FORT BRAGG SCHOOLS REORGANIZATION AND REDISTRICTING PLAN
SY 2011-2012
REORGANIZATION
Fort Bragg School’s grade level structure will be reorganized to reflect….
Two middle schools (grades 6-8) Two primary schools (grades PreK-2) One intermediate school (grades 3-5) Seven elementary schools (grades
PreK-5)
Middle Schools
Albritton Middle School – located on Fort Bragg, will house approximately 670 middle school students
New Middle School – located at Linden Oaks, will initially house approximately 480 middle school students
Primary Schools
Butner Primary School, located on Normandy Drive, Butner will house approximately 480 PreK-2nd grade students and will feed Irwin Intermediate School.
Murray Primary School- located on Honeycutt Drive will house approximately 260 PreK-2nd grade students and will feed Irwin Intermediate School
Intermediate School
Irwin Intermediate School will eventually be located on Rhine Road and serve approximately 450 students in grades three through five.
Until completion in 2012, these students will be bussed to the existing Irwin School on Knox Street.
Elementary Schools
The following schools will serve students PreK-5th grade: (approximate enrollments)
Bowley - 340 Devers - 425 Gordon - 520 Holbrook - 285 McNair - 300 Pope – 325 New Elementary at L.O. - 660

Transportation Costs
Bussing will be reduced approximately 50% in 2011-2012
Bussing will be reduced approximately 60% beginning SY 2012-2013 when the new Irwin Intermediate School opens on Rhine Road
Only two buses will be travelling between post and Linden Oaks (middle school students from Pope to New Linden Oaks Middle School).
